Connecting to Other Devices
If you connect the RG-1F/RG-3F to powered speakers or to an
audio system that has line input jacks, you’ll be able to hear the
RG-1F/RG-3F’s sound from your powered speakers or audio
system. If you connect your portable audio player or other audio
playback device to the RG-1F/RG-3F, you’ll be able to hear its
sound via the RG-1F/RG-3F.
Use audio cables (commercially available) to make connections.
When connection cables with resistors are used, the
volume level of equipment connected to the inputs
jacks may be low. If this happens, use connection cables
that do not contain resistors.

To prevent malfunction and/or damage to speakers or
other devices, always turn down the volume, and turn
off the power on all devices before making any
connections.

1.
Turn the volume all the way down on the RG-1F/RG-3F
and on the speaker.
2.
Turn off the power to the RG-1F/RG-3F and speakers.
3.
Use audio cables (commercially available) to make the
connection.
4.
Switch on the RG-1F/RG-3F.
5.
Switch on the connected speakers.
6.
Adjust the volume level on the RG-1F/RG-3F and the
connected speakers.
When you play the RG-1F/RG-3F’s keyboard, the sound is
played from the RG-1F/RG-3F’s and connected speakers.
Turning Off the Power
1.
Turn the volume all the way down on the RG-1F/RG-3F
and on the connected speakers.
2.
Turn off the connected speakers.
3.
Turn off the RG-1F/RG-3F.
